Curriculum Overview

The curriculum of the Food Control and Analysis program at Gelişim University combines fundamental concepts of food science with advanced analytical techniques. Students will learn about the biochemical composition of food, the role of food control systems, and how to assess food quality through modern testing methods. The program also emphasizes the importance of compliance with national and international food safety standards.

Core Foundations

  • Introduction to Food Science and Technology: Understand the basic principles of food science, including the composition of food, food processing techniques, and the role of food chemistry in product quality and safety.
  • Food Quality Assurance: Study the processes and methodologies used to maintain and ensure consistent food quality, including sensory evaluation, microbiological testing, and quality control standards in food production.
  • Food Safety and Regulations: Learn about the national and international food safety regulations, including standards set by the Food and Drug Administration (FDA), World Health Organization (WHO), and Codex Alimentarius. Understand the legal requirements for food labeling, hygiene, and traceability.
  • Food Microbiology: Explore the microorganisms present in food, including beneficial microbes and pathogens, and learn how they affect food safety and spoilage. Study the techniques used to detect and control harmful microorganisms in food.
  • Food Chemistry and Nutritional Analysis: Gain an understanding of the chemical composition of food, including nutrients, additives, preservatives, and contaminants. Learn how to analyze food for nutritional content and identify harmful substances.
  • Food Testing and Analytical Techniques: Study laboratory techniques used for analyzing food, including chromatography, spectrometry, and other advanced analytical methods to assess food quality, safety, and authenticity.
  • Food Packaging and Preservation: Understand the role of packaging materials and techniques in extending the shelf life of food products while preserving their nutritional value and preventing contamination.

Specialized Topics in Food Control and Analysis

  • Food Contaminants and Toxins: Study common contaminants and toxins in food, including pesticides, heavy metals, and natural toxins. Learn how to detect, monitor, and manage these hazards in food products.
  • Sensory Evaluation of Food: Explore techniques for assessing food quality through sensory analysis, including taste tests, aroma profiling, and texture analysis to ensure consumer satisfaction.
  • Food Additives and Preservatives: Learn about the various additives and preservatives used in food processing, including their functions, safety standards, and regulatory considerations.
  • Food Fraud and Authentication: Investigate the issues of food fraud and adulteration, including methods for detecting fake or misleading food products and ensuring authenticity in food labeling and production.
  • Sustainability in Food Production: Study sustainable practices in food production, including eco-friendly packaging, waste reduction, and methods to minimize the environmental impact of food manufacturing and distribution.

Career Opportunities

Graduates of the Food Control and Analysis program are prepared for a variety of roles in the food industry, including:

  • Food Quality Control Analyst: Monitor and evaluate the quality of food products, ensuring compliance with safety standards, regulations, and quality assurance protocols.
  • Food Safety Officer: Oversee food safety programs, ensuring that food products are safe for consumption and that manufacturing practices adhere to regulatory standards.
  • Regulatory Compliance Officer: Ensure that food products and production facilities meet local and international regulations, including quality, labeling, and food safety standards.
  • Food Research and Development (R&D) Specialist: Work in food product innovation, developing new food items, formulations, and improving food processing techniques while ensuring safety and nutritional quality.
  • Food Safety Auditor: Conduct audits of food facilities, ensuring adherence to food safety standards and identifying potential hazards or non-compliance issues in production.
  • Food Lab Technician: Perform testing and analysis on food samples, identifying chemical, biological, and physical properties to ensure quality and safety.
